Why sendmail is not sending emails to the correct smtpserver?
Issue
- The SMTP server has IP address X.X.X.X. While sending an email, connection is getting timed out and it is pointing to a wrong SMTP server with different IP address.
- Following logs are observed in
/var/log/maillog
Jan 14 15:11:45 test postfix/smtp[6103]: 5C23A280067: to=<abc@example.net>, relay=none, delay=2343, delays=2313/0.04/30/0, dsn=4.4.1, status=deferred (connect to example.net[x.x.x.x]:25: Connection timed out)
Environment
-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6
